My son started beginners karate a few weeks ago. I'm so impressed with the teachers here. My son loves going to karate! The teachers are very patient with the kids. They are not only teaching karate, but respect as well. The teachers are excellent at handling multiple students as well as providing one on one feedback as needed. You can feel the passion each teacher and student holds for karate here. I highly recommend this location. The school is even hosting a mother/son event for Mother's day and hosting an event for Father's day!
